VVT Sensor: Installation: Installation

WARNING: This page is about a different car, the 2010 Lexus GS 350. However, it is still accessible from the selected car via links, so may be relevant.
  1. INSTALL VVT SENSOR (for Exhaust Side of Bank 2) 
    1. Install the sensor with the bolt.
      Fig 1: Identifying VVT Sensor (Exhaust Side Of Bank 2)
      GTY105035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002

      Torque: 10 N*m (102 kgf*cm, 7 ft.*lbf) 

    2. Connect the sensor connector.
  2. INSTALL VVT SENSOR (for Intake Side of Bank 2) 
    1. Install the sensor with the bolt.
      Fig 2: Identifying VVT Sensor (For Intake Side Of Bank 2)
      GTY104809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002

      Torque: 10 N*m (102 kgf*cm, 7 ft.*lbf) 

    2. Connect the sensor connector.
  3. INSTALL VVT SENSOR (for Exhaust Side of Bank 1) 
    1. Install the sensor with the bolt.
      Fig 3: Identifying VVT Sensor (Exhaust Side Of Bank 1)
      GTY103256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002

      Torque: 10 N*m (102 kgf*cm, 7 ft.*lbf) 

    2. Connect the sensor connector.
  4. INSTALL VVT SENSOR (for Intake Side of Bank 1) 
    1. Install the sensor with the bolt.
      Fig 4: Identifying VVT Sensor (For Intake Side Of Bank 1)
      GTY101436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002

      Torque: 10 N*m (102 kgf*cm, 7 ft.*lbf) 

    2. Connect the sensor connector.
  5. INSTALL V-BANK COVER  . Refer to INSTALLATION - Step 132
  6. CONNECT CABLE TO NEGATIVE BATTERY TERMINAL 
  7. PERFORM INITIALIZATION 
    1. Perform initialization. Refer to INITIALIZATION .
      NOTE:

      Certain systems need to be initialized after disconnecting and reconnecting the cable from the negative (-) battery terminal.
